Default roof will not open

20051.8 tt roof will not open cant hear any noises and wind deflector has stopped working at the same time .no warning indicators. can any one plse help. many tks

Easiest thing first, check the fuse. You need to remove the trim panel under the steering column, 2 torx head screws down low near the pedals and another 1 or 2 that you remove from the main fuse box on the side of the dash. Look under there and you should see something like the picture below.

https://www.audiworld.com/tech/pics/...exhaust004.jpg

The 2 fuses at the bottom right are both 30 amp fuses, one for the convertible top and the other for the wind deflector.

The control module has several checks before sending power to open or close the top so you might check those out too. There is a switch at the top of the windshield to tell the control module if the top is latched or not. There are 2 switches to tell the computer if the top cover is in place. There is a signal from somewhere, probably the main ECU, that will prevent the top from opening or closing while the car is moving. I have read that there is a switch that will not allow the top to operate unless the emergency brake is on but that isn't true on my 01 TT, I can open and close the top without the brake on.

The wind deflector will not work if the top is up so if you can't put the top down it is logical that the wind deflector is not working.
